My understanding of the Caller ID Table (Programs 110-111) is that if an 
incoming call has caller ID, and matches a number in the Caller ID Code Set, then 
the corresponding Caller ID Name is displayed instead of whatever info the 
Caller ID carries.

However, all of my incoming calls just display the calling number, and 
whatever else the telco sends (usually "Out Of Area")!

Am I missing something?  What format should the Caller ID codes be stored in- 
with hyphens, no hyphens, etc. etc.?  I've tried various combinations, but 
the system appears to ignore the tables completely!

And yes, Program 406 is set to enable the lines.
